Dark colours on top
Light on bottom
V-necks
Scoopnecks
Diagonally cut sleeves
No horiztonal stripes.Especially if they're across the shoulders.

>>7303668
in general, you'll want to mix and match the advice given to rectangle women (no hips, no shoulders, no tits) and inverted triangle women (no hips, big shoulders, big tits)
that's one reason why implants are so common for trans women, it makes fashion easier
don't wear things that show your shoulders, even cis women look like linebackers in them
focus on skirts and dresses rather than pants
skirts are also good for accenuating your legs, which are the one consistent advantage trans girls have over cis girls -- natal males have longer legs as a proportion of height, and long slim legs with female fat distribution = attractive
